A New 3D Virtual Reality-based Upper Limb Training to Improve Dexterity in Parkinson's Disease: a Randomized Pilot Study

Status: Recruiting
Location: See location...
Intervention Type: Other
Study Type: Interventional
Study Phase: Not Applicable
SUMMARY

We investigate the impact of a 4-week virtual reality-based upper limb training in Parkinson's disease. The benefits on dexterity of this training program will be evaluated. For these purposes, a randomised, two arm, single assessor blind, parallel design with a monocentric, study setup will be performed.

• Patients with confirmed PD, according to UK Brain bank Criteria

• Hoehn \& Yahr Stadium I to IV

• Age 40 to 99 years

• written and signed informed consent

• self-reported dexterous difficulties
